Understanding Dental Implants
A dental implant is a small titanium post that serves as a replacement for the root of a missing tooth. When placed into the jawbone, it acts as the anchor for a crown, bridge, or even complete dentures. Gradually, the implant fuses with your bone in a procedure called osseointegration, developing a stable and long lasting foundation.
This technique not just restores your smile but likewise helps preserve jawbone structure-- something conventional dentures can refrain from doing. As a result, numerous dental experts in Jacksonville think about implants the gold requirement for tooth replacement.
Who Makes a Great Candidate?
Not everyone is automatically eligible for dental implants. Dentists in Jacksonville emphasize the importance of assessing several aspects before continuing. Your total health, oral hygiene, and bone density are crucial factors to consider.
Generally, candidates must be in excellent health, devoid of gum illness, and have sufficient jawbone to support the implant. Smokers, individuals with unchecked diabetes, or those with certain autoimmune disorders might require extra assessment or alternative services. However, even if you've been told in the past that you're not a prospect, developments in dental innovation might now offer choices for you.
What Are the Advantages of Dental Implants?
Among the most common questions dental experts receive from Jacksonville patients is, "Why should I choose implants over other alternatives?" The answer lies in the variety of benefits implants use-- both cosmetic and functional. Here's a closer take a look at what makes implants a leading option:
Natural Look and Feel
Oral implants are developed to look, feel, and function like natural teeth. The crown is custom-made to match the color and shape of your existing teeth, making the implant practically undetectable.
Long-Term Option
While dentures and bridges might require to be changed or adjusted every few years, implants can last a lifetime with appropriate care. This long-lasting durability often makes them a more affordable alternative gradually.
Bone Health Conservation
When a tooth is lost, the jawbone because area starts to weaken due to lack of stimulation. Implants simulate the natural root, helping maintain bone mass and facial structure.
Enhanced Confidence and Comfort
Since they're secured directly in the jawbone, implants do not slip or shift like dentures. This stability implies you can consume, speak, and smile confidently without fretting about discomfort or shame.
What to Expect During the Process.
The journey to getting an oral implant in Jacksonville normally begins with an assessment. Your dental professional will take a comprehensive medical and dental history, followed by digital imaging like X-rays or 3D scans to assess your bone density and gum health.
The implant is surgically placed in the jawbone. After a few months of healing and integration, an abutment is connected to the post.
While the procedure might take a number of months, a lot of patients discover the results well worth the wait. Throughout the journey, Jacksonville dental experts ensure that you're comfy and totally informed at each step.
Considerations Before Selecting Implants
Deciding to get dental implants involves more than simply a desire for a much better smile. Here are a couple of crucial things to think about before dedicating to the procedure:
Expense. Dental implants are an investment, and while they can be more expensive in advance than other tooth replacement choices, many clients find the advantages surpass the cost in the long run. Some oral offices in Jacksonville provide funding or payment strategies to make the process more accessible.
Time Dedication. Due to the fact that of the healing procedure, dental implants are not a same-day solution. You should be prepared for a treatment timeline that may cover numerous months. The outcome is a permanent restoration that can last for years.
Oral Health. Implants require the same care as your natural teeth-- brushing, flossing, and routine oral visits. Maintaining excellent oral health is important to ensure the longevity of your implant.
Alternatives to Dental Implants
While implants are a wonderful option for numerous individuals, they aren't the only service. Jacksonville dental experts frequently go over options with clients based upon their requirements, spending plan, and health history. These may include removable dentures, repaired bridges, or implant-supported dentures for those who might not certify for single implants however still want included stability.
For some clients, a bone graft might be recommended before implant positioning if there isn't sufficient existing jawbone. This can increase your eligibility and enhance the possibilities of long-term success.
